Abstract

The invention discloses a kind of PPR electric tubes formula, including PPR, zinc stearate, phytic acid, diisononyl phthalate, polyisobutene, lithopone, dimethylbenzene, HMPA, cyclohexanone, ultramarine and brightener.The present invention extends the service life of PPR electric tubes, improves the electric property of PPR electric tubes.

Description

A kind of PPR electric tubes formula
Technical field
The present invention relates to a kind of PPR electric tubes formula, belong to plastic conduit technical field.
Background technology
PPR pipe has energy-saving material-saving, environmental protection, light compared with the pipelines such as traditional cast iron pipe, coating steel pipe, pipe of cement Matter is high-strength, construction and simple and convenient for maintenance.In recent years, with construction industry, municipal works, hydraulic engineering, agricultural and industry etc. Industry market demand continues to increase, and Chinese PPR pipe industry presents high speed development situation.
PPR pipe road is with more in life, and wherein electric tube is its most common use, and this just needs PPR pipe to have preferably Electric property.
The content of the invention
To overcome above-mentioned deficiency, the object of the invention provides a kind of PPR electric tubes formula.
The solution of the present invention is as follows:A kind of PPR electric tubes formula, it is made up of according to parts by weight following raw material:PPR70~ 120 parts, 10 ~ 25 parts of zinc stearate, 10 ~ 20 parts of phytic acid, 20 ~ 40 parts of diisononyl phthalate, polyisobutene 2 ~ 5 Part, 10 ~ 20 parts of lithopone, 5 ~ 10 parts of dimethylbenzene, 5 ~ 10 parts of HMPA, 3 ~ 8 parts of cyclohexanone, 2 ~ 6 parts of ultramarine and light Bright dose 1 ~ 3 part.
Further, it is made up of according to parts by weight following raw material:PPR80 parts, 15 parts of zinc stearate, phytic acid 12 Part, 25 parts of diisononyl phthalate, 3 parts of polyisobutene, 15 parts of lithopone, 6 parts of dimethylbenzene, 7 parts of HMPA, 3 parts of 4 parts of cyclohexanone, 3 parts of ultramarine and brightener.
Further, it is made up of according to parts by weight following raw material:PPR90 parts, 20 parts of zinc stearate, phytic acid 15 Part, 30 parts of diisononyl phthalate, 4 parts of polyisobutene, 18 parts of lithopone, 7 parts of dimethylbenzene, 8 parts of HMPA, 2 parts of 5 parts of cyclohexanone, 4 parts of ultramarine and brightener.
Further, it is made up of according to parts by weight following raw material:PPR105 parts, 22 parts of zinc stearate, phytic acid 17 Part, 35 parts of diisononyl phthalate, 3 parts of polyisobutene, 16 parts of lithopone, 8 parts of dimethylbenzene, 6 parts of HMPA, 1 part of 6 parts of cyclohexanone, 5 parts of ultramarine and brightener.
Beneficial effects of the present invention:The present invention extends the service life of PPR electric tubes, improves the electrical resistance of PPR electric tubes Energy.
